That, is the initial assessment of anchor Talat Hussain. He was speaking about the terror attack on PNS Mehran, where 10-15 terrorists attacked and destroyed 2 PC3-Orion surveillance and reconnaissance aircrafts, used to detect enemy submarines off the coast of the Arabian Sea.

These aircrafts were primarily to guard and defend against indian aggression.
